About us

MBP Solutions was founded in 1999 and specialises in adding value to biological by-products through unique know-how regarding product applications, sustainability, sales and marketing, legal compliance and supply chain management. 

With a focus on the utilisation of the resources in biological by-products, MBP Solutions has developed a unique service called OMBP (Outsourced Management of By-Products) 360ᵒ solutions – where by-products and wastes from 33 different factories in Europe and North America are managed in a sustainable way.

Why work for us?

Sustainability has been part of our ideological backbone since the beginning, as our organisation captures and delivers value in economic, environmental and social terms. Our business brings to life the concepts of industrial ecology and circular economy by materialising the idea that the waste stream of one industry can be used as a key resource by another. 

Our technical expertise, market knowledge and legal understanding help to promote the optimal and efficient use of natural resources, reduce waste and toxic emissions, reduce operating costs and generate new revenue.  As a result, we improve the environmental, economic and social performance of our suppliers and customers, with whom we work together to enable the recycling and recovery of residual resources. MBP has several sustainability and quality certifications and works actively with LEAN.
